BBVA says commitment to Turkey unchanged, shares fall 6%
Spain’s BBVA on Monday said its commitment to Turkey was unchanged despite a 15 percent decline in Turkey’s lira to a near all-time low after President Tayyip Erdogan’s ousting of a hawkish central bank governor. The sacking of Naci Agbal, appointed less than five months ago, sparked fears of a…
